Question

How does an IGMP router learns about the existence of hosts in multicast groups

Options

  • ABy receiving a response on an IGMP membership query
  • BBy looking into the ARP cache
  • CThere is no dynamic learning process, instead static FDB entries are used
  • DNone of the above
